You can buy office supplies both online and in physical stores; the best option depends on whether you prioritize speed, price, bulk discounts, or supporting local shops.
Quick Scoop: Main Options
1. Big office-supply chains (online + in-store)
These are good if you want a mix of in-person browsing and fast delivery.
- Staples: Wide range of supplies, furniture, tech, and printing services, with free nextâday shipping on many orders and inâstore pickup options.
- Office Depot / OfficeMax: Focus on small and midâsize businesses, with low prices, regular promotions, printing services, and local pickup or delivery.
Best for: Everyday office needs, lastâminute items, and when you want to see chairs/desks in person before buying.
2. Large online marketplaces
These are ideal if you want convenience, huge selection, and bulk options.
- Amazon Business: Very wide range of products, bulk purchase options, and businessâonly pricing plus tools for multiâuser accounts and spend controls.
- Walmart (online): Cheap everyday stationery, bulk options, and the ability to pick up in store if you prefer.
Best for: Small offices and home offices that want lower prices, fast shipping, and one-stop ordering.
3. Specialist office-supply sites
These can offer better bulk pricing or more tailored business features.
- The CEO Creative: Targets startups and small businesses, with features like Net 30 accounts so you can buy now and pay later on supplies.
- Bulk Office Supply: Focuses on wholesale pricing, offering over 20% off typical superâstore prices on items like paper, toner, pens, and cleaning supplies.
- OfficeSupply.com: Dedicated office-supply store with paper, ink, binders, electronics, cleaning products, and free or fast shipping options.
Best for: Buying in bulk, stretching a budget, or setting up regular supply orders.
4. Trendy / design-focused brands
If you care about aesthetics as well as function:
- Poppin: Sells modern, colorâcoordinated office supplies and desk accessories like pens, notebooks, and organizers.
Best for: Stylish home offices, creative teams, or clientâfacing spaces where look and feel matter.
5. Local and independent options
- Local office supply stores or stationery shops often give more personal service and may be more flexible on special orders.
- Some businesses consciously choose a âlocalâ chain like Staples as their regular stop to support jobs in their area.
Best for: Supporting local business, getting advice from humans, and resolving issues faceâtoâface.
